@@ -129,14 +129,19 @@ static apr_status_t ap_cleanup_shared_mem(void *d)
     return APR_SUCCESS;
 }
 
+#define SIZE_OF_scoreboard    APR_ALIGN_DEFAULT(sizeof(scoreboard))
+#define SIZE_OF_global_score  APR_ALIGN_DEFAULT(sizeof(global_score))
+#define SIZE_OF_process_score APR_ALIGN_DEFAULT(sizeof(process_score))
+#define SIZE_OF_worker_score  APR_ALIGN_DEFAULT(sizeof(worker_score))
+
 AP_DECLARE(int) ap_calc_scoreboard_size(void)
 {
     ap_mpm_query(AP_MPMQ_HARD_LIMIT_THREADS, &thread_limit);
     ap_mpm_query(AP_MPMQ_HARD_LIMIT_DAEMONS, &server_limit);
 
-    scoreboard_size = sizeof(global_score);
-    scoreboard_size += sizeof(process_score) * server_limit;
-    scoreboard_size += sizeof(worker_score) * server_limit * thread_limit;
+    scoreboard_size  = SIZE_OF_global_score;
+    scoreboard_size += SIZE_OF_process_score * server_limit;
+    scoreboard_size += SIZE_OF_worker_score * server_limit * thread_limit;
 
     return scoreboard_size;
 }
